A Compliance Learning Management System (LMS) is a comprehensive digital platform meticulously crafted to administer, deliver, track, and report on compliance training initiatives within organizations. Certifications Provides verifiable evidence of training completion through certificates with expiration dates and re-certification reminders.

According to a survey by Landles-Cobb, Kramer, and Smith Milway (2015), the second most cited reason for staff turnover, behind low compensation, was lack of leadership development and growth opportunity. Organizations can start small, perhaps focusing on a few emerging leaders, and build structured leadership development systems over time.
